At its core, the injection moulding system consists of melting plastic material and injecting it into a mould cavity, exactly where it cools and solidifies into the specified condition. The cycle starts with feeding thermoplastic granules into a heated barrel. In the barrel, a screw mechanism moves and melts the plastic through both equally friction and external heating. After the fabric reaches a molten point out, it truly is injected into a pre-created mould less than superior pressure. The molten plastic fills each and every element of your cavity, making certain that even advanced styles are precisely reproduced. After cooling, the mould opens, as well as the solidified part is ejected, Completely ready for any needed ending touches. This cycle repeats quickly, permitting for mass manufacturing with minimal human intervention.

Excellent Regulate plays a critical role in making sure the results with the injection moulding course of action. Companies ought to keep exact Command over parameters including temperature, force, and cooling time to realize consistent success. Versions in these elements can cause defects like warping, sink marks, or incomplete fills. Present day injection moulding machines are equipped with checking devices that quickly alter and document these variables, making certain Every single cycle meets the exact same higher standards. Ongoing improvement and frequent routine maintenance additional guarantee that the process delivers reliable, large-quality outcomes eventually.

One more essential component of the injection moulding process is mould style. The mould alone decides the ultimate condition, sizing, and surface finish on the element. Competent engineers use CAD software program to create in-depth moulds that permit for sleek filling, uniform cooling, and simple ejection with the finished ingredient. Moulds are frequently made from sturdy products for example hardened metal or aluminium, based on the output volume and complexity. A perfectly-created mould assures merchandise uniformity and longevity, that is significant for maintaining effectiveness and decreasing downtime.
